Interior Tunnel with Soldiers

Copy negative of a group of eight men inside Cumbre Tunnel on a small bridge and rail-car during the Pancho Villa raids. The note on the picture says, "Interior of Cumbre Tunnel where 51 lives were lost. The bandit Maximo Castillo is blamed for the disaster."

Mexican Officers

Copy negative of six Mexican men, including Generals Fierro, Villa and Ortega and Colonel Medina. The men are all wearing cowboy hats, coats and boots. In the lower left hand corner of the image are the words, "829. W.M. Horne Co." and "1. Gen. Fierro. 2. Gen. Villa. 3. Gen. Ortega. 4. Col. Medina."

Military Airplanes

Copy negative of a squadron of military airplanes in Mexico. The planes are lined up on the ground and several military personnel are crowded around them. Written across the bottom of the image is, "Squadron of Military Airplanes being used in the Campaign against Pancho Villa." In the bottom left-hand corner is, "W.H. Horne Co., El Paso, Tex. 3030".
